benzyl
noun ben·zyl \ˈben-ˌzēl, -zəl\
Definition of BENZYL
: a monovalent radical C6H5CH2− derived from toluene
— ben·zyl·ic \ben-ˈzi-lik\ adjective

Origin of BENZYL
International Scientific Vocabulary benz- + -yl
